CSS样式优先级是指当多个CSS规则应用于同一元素时,浏览器如何确定应用哪个规则。CSS样式优先级由以下因素决定,按照优先级从高到低的顺序排列:

  1. !important:在属性值后面加上!important,可以将该属性的优先级提高到最高级别,即使后面有相同属性的规则也会被覆盖。
  2. 内联样式:在元素内部使用style属性定义的样式具有最高优先级。
  3. ID选择器:使用ID选择器定义的样式优先级高于以下选择器。
  4. 类选择器、属性选择器、伪类选择器:这些选择器的优先级相同,且优先级低于ID选择器。
  5. 元素选择器、伪元素选择器:这些选择器的优先级最低,除非它们与其他选择器组合使用,否则它们的优先级低于以上选择器。

需要注意的是,当多个选择器具有相同的优先级时,后面定义的规则会覆盖先前定义的规则。另外,继承的样式优先级低于上述所有选择器。

能说一下css的样式优先级

原文地址: https://www.cveoy.top/t/topic/FEy 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录